EasyMarkets Overview for Georgia

EasyMarkets, founded in 2001 and headquartered in Cyprus, is a well-established forex and CFD broker that has built a reputation for simplicity and innovation. For Georgia traders, EasyMarkets offers a low minimum deposit of just $25 (USD), making it accessible for retail traders. The broker supports local payment methods such as Bank Transfer, Skrill, and USDT, which are widely used in Georgia. While the broker is not regulated by Georgia's local financial authority, it holds licenses from CySEC, ASIC, and the FSA, providing a reasonable level of security. EasyMarkets is particularly relevant for Georgian traders who value fixed spreads, a user-friendly proprietary platform, and features like deal cancellation and guaranteed stop-loss. However, the lack of popular platforms like MT4/MT5 and limited local language support may be drawbacks for some. Overall, EasyMarkets is a solid choice for beginners and those who prefer a straightforward trading experience.

Islamic Account — Georgia Muslim Traders

EasyMarkets offers a genuine swap-free Islamic account that complies with Sharia law. For Georgia's Muslim traders, this account eliminates all overnight interest (swap) charges, making it halal for long-term trading. There are no hidden fees, and the account is available upon request. To apply, simply open a live account and contact customer support to convert it to an Islamic account. The process is straightforward and free. However, note that some brokers restrict Islamic accounts to certain instruments or require a minimum deposit, but EasyMarkets does not impose such limits. This makes it a good option for Muslim traders in Georgia who want a truly swap-free experience.

Common Mistakes Georgia Traders Make with EasyMarkets

  • Mistake: Not verifying EasyMarkets' license numbers on CySEC or ASIC websites – always double-check to ensure the broker is in good standing.
  • Mistake: Assuming the proprietary platform is as powerful as MT4/MT5 – it's simpler, so test the demo first to see if it meets your needs.
  • Mistake: Ignoring withdrawal fees – while deposits are free, withdrawals via bank transfer may incur fees; check the broker's fee schedule.
